Cost of Structural Concrete Repair in Frederick
Structural concrete repair is a crucial aspect of maintaining the integrity and safety of buildings and infrastructure in Frederick, MD. Whether it's a residential property or a commercial building, understanding the costs involved in structural concrete repair can help property owners budget effectively and make informed decisions.
Factors Affecting Cost
- Extent of Damage: The severity of the concrete damage greatly influences the overall repair cost.
- Type of Repair Needed: Different repair methods, such as patching, resurfacing, or full replacement, vary in cost.
- Labor Costs: The price of labor can fluctuate based on the expertise required and the local market rates in Frederick, MD.
- Materials Used: High-quality materials might cost more but can provide longer-lasting results.
- Accessibility of the Site: Hard-to-reach areas may incur additional costs due to the complexity of the repair process.
- Permits and Inspections: Local regulations may require permits and inspections, adding to the total cost.
- Weather Conditions: Seasonal weather in Frederick, MD can affect the timing and cost of repairs.
Common Tasks and Costs
Task Description | Average Cost Range |
---|---|
Minor Crack Repair | $300 - $800 |
Surface Resurfacing | $2,000 - $4,000 |
Full Concrete Replacement | $5,000 - $15,000 |
Foundation Repair | $3,000 - $10,000 |
Waterproofing | $1,500 - $5,000 |
Reinforcement Installation | $2,500 - $7,500 |
Epoxy Injection for Cracks | $500 - $1,200 |
